With all of the great things to do in Milwaukee, it is easy to lose yourself for an afternoon or even an entire weekend. If you want to get a little lost or go out of the way, then you may want to check out Milwaukee’s outer border. Stick to the lakes and parks, or even a house with a bowling alley in the basement.
Revel in an indoor art walk amid priceless works at the Milwaukee Art Museum. You will find yourself easily captivated not only by the art, but by the architecture of this unique building. And if a nature walk is more your style, then look to the Urban Ecology Center where you can take a long walk and even rent kayaks.
Check out South Shore Park in the Bay View neighborhood and hang out at the Miller Beer Garden. Do this before and after partaking in any of the fantastic restaurants in the area, in particular the Palomino where the Biscuit Sammy will put a smile on your face.
In the evening, you may want to relax with some bowling. Stop by the Holler House for a game. Be sure to book in advance; the pins here are set manually since it is the oldest sanctioned bowling alley in the United States dating back to 1908.
If you need the euphoria of a sugar rush to make you forget your troubles, sit down at Honeypie. Here you can select any number of perfect slices made with locally sourced Wisconsin ingredients.

Earn a free night with BWH Hotels this spring by being a member of its Best Western Rewards loyalty program. Through May 5, BWR members who stay two nights (do not need to be consecutive) at BWH Hotels properties in the United States, Canada and the Caribbean will earn one free night to be used for stays through Aug. 25. Register for the promotion prior to the completion of your first stay online or with the hotel directly. The awarded free night is eligible at any Best Western-branded hotel in the United States, Canada and the Caribbean, and members can only earn one free night via the promotion.
